Biography

Name: Lydia Throop -- AKA: Lydia Throope, Lydia Cary, Lidia Carey, et al.

Lydia (or Lidiah) was the youngest child of William Throope and his wife Mary Chapman. She was born at Bristol, Rhode Island on 15 July 1686, the earliest Throop(e) birth registered at that place in the records. [1] In her father's will of 1704, he described his "two youngest daughters to witt Mercey & Lidiah" implying that Mercy was the older of the two.

Lydia was wed to Eleazer Cary Abt. 1703 "...and removed to Windham about 1718, [Eleazer] having bought land there..." [2] she was found as a Windham Congregational Church communicant in 1726.[3]

Lydia passed away 12 Jun 1761 Wintonbury, Connecticut, at the age of 76. [4][Ref. Research Note #2] She was buried in the Windham Center Cemetery; Windham, Windham County, Connecticut.[5]

Research Notes

  1. Some online trees have Mercy and Lydia as twins, but Mercy is not recorded in the Bristol register, and therefore is unlikely to be Lydia's twin.
  2. Lydia Cary in the Connecticut, U.S., Hale Collection of Cemetery Inscriptions and Newspaper Notices, 1629-1934 places her death age as 75.[6]
